租服务器是一项需要谨慎考虑的任务,需要选择可靠的供应商、了解服务器配置、选择合适的操作系统和带宽等,在租服务器前,需要明确自己的需求,包括用途、预算、地理位置等,选择供应商时,需要查看其信誉、价格、技术支持等,服务器配置包括CPU、内存、硬盘等,需要根据实际需求进行选择,操作系统和带宽也需要根据使用场景进行选择,在租服务器后,需要安装必要的软件、配置环境、备份数据等,还需要注意服务器的安全性,包括防火墙、入侵检测等,租服务器需要综合考虑多个因素,以确保服务器的稳定性和安全性。
在数字化时代,服务器成为企业、个人运营网站、应用程序及存储数据的重要工具,购买和维护自己的服务器需要专业知识和大量资金,租赁服务器成为越来越多人的选择,本文将详细介绍如何租服务器,包括选择供应商、配置服务器、管理账户以及优化成本等各个方面。
选择服务器租赁供应商
-
市场研究 在选择供应商之前,进行市场研究是至关重要的,可以通过互联网搜索、行业论坛、专业评测网站等途径了解各大供应商的评价和口碑,重点关注用户反馈、服务稳定性、技术支持等方面。
-
供应商比较 比较不同供应商的定价策略、服务内容、合同条款等,一些供应商可能提供按小时或按使用量计费的模式,而另一些可能采用包年或包月的固定价格,了解这些差异有助于做出更合适的选择。
-
数据安全性 数据安全性是选择供应商时不可忽视的因素,确保供应商遵循行业安全标准,如ISO 27001等,并具备强大的防火墙和加密技术,了解数据备份和恢复策略也是关键。
-
地理位置 服务器的地理位置会影响访问速度和延迟,选择靠近目标用户群体的服务器可以显著提高网站或应用的性能,考虑供应商的全球数据中心布局,以便在需要时进行扩展。
配置服务器
-
操作系统选择 常见的服务器操作系统包括Linux(如Ubuntu、CentOS)和Windows(如Windows Server),Linux通常更受开发者青睐,因其开源特性和较低的成本;而Windows则更适合需要特定微软技术(如.NET框架)的应用。
-
硬件规格 根据需求选择合适的CPU、内存、存储和带宽,高并发应用可能需要更快的CPU和更多的内存;而存储密集型应用则需要更大的硬盘空间,考虑SSD(固态硬盘)以提高I/O性能。
-
软件环境 根据应用需求安装必要的软件,如数据库(MySQL、PostgreSQL)、Web服务器(Apache、Nginx)、编程语言环境(Python、Java)等,提前规划好软件架构和依赖关系,以便快速部署和配置。
-
安全配置 配置防火墙规则以限制不必要的网络访问;安装SSL证书以确保数据传输安全;定期更新操作系统和软件补丁以防范安全漏洞,考虑启用DDoS防护服务以抵御恶意攻击。
管理服务器账户
-
访问控制 设置严格的访问权限,确保只有授权人员能够访问服务器,使用SSH密钥进行身份验证可以提高安全性并简化登录流程,定期更换密码和密钥是良好的安全习惯。
-
监控与日志 安装监控工具(如Nagios、Zabbix)以实时监控服务器的健康状况和性能指标,启用日志记录功能以便在出现问题时能够追溯原因并排查故障,定期审查日志文件也是发现潜在安全威胁的有效途径。
-
备份与恢复 制定备份策略并定期执行备份操作,确保数据的安全性,考虑将备份存储在异地或云存储中以防灾难性事件导致数据丢失,定期测试恢复过程以确保备份的有效性。
-
自动化与脚本化 利用脚本和自动化工具(如Ansible、Puppet)简化服务器管理和维护任务,这些工具可以帮助你快速部署新环境、更新软件版本或执行其他重复性操作,掌握这些技能将大大提高工作效率并减少人为错误。
优化成本与性能
-
按需扩展 根据业务需求动态调整服务器资源,避免资源浪费和过度投资,使用云服务商的弹性伸缩功能可以根据流量变化自动调整服务器规模,从而降低成本并提高资源利用率。
-
成本分析 定期审查服务器成本,包括硬件购置费、云服务费用、运维成本等,利用成本分析工具(如AWS Cost Explorer)了解成本分布并识别潜在节省机会,通过优化资源使用和采用更经济的服务选项来降低总体拥有成本(TCO)。
-
性能优化 通过缓存技术(如Redis、Memcached)、负载均衡(Nginx)、内容分发网络(CDN)等手段提高服务器性能,优化代码和数据库查询以减少资源消耗和响应时间,定期评估性能指标并根据需要进行调整和优化。
-
绿色计算 考虑采用绿色计算技术和节能设备以减少碳足迹和运营成本,选择能效更高的服务器硬件和使用可再生能源供电的数据中心,虽然这些措施可能增加初期投资,但长期来看将带来显著的环保效益和经济回报。
总结与建议
租赁服务器是一个涉及多个方面的复杂过程,需要仔细规划和执行以确保高效、安全和可扩展的IT基础设施,在选择供应商时,务必进行充分的市场研究和比较;在配置服务器时,根据实际需求选择合适的硬件和软件;在管理账户时,实施严格的安全措施和自动化工具;在优化成本与性能时,采用按需扩展和性能优化策略,通过遵循这些步骤和建议,你将能够成功租赁并管理自己的服务器以满足各种业务需求。

